12 Morlais Street, Barry, CF63 2PB is a freehold terraced property built between 1900-1929. The property offers approximately 560 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have one bedroom.

The estimated current market value of the property is £172,180 , which equates to approximately £308 per square foot. It was last sold on 13 Nov 2014 for £105,000. Since then, the value has increased by £67,180, representing a 64.0% increase, or approximately 5.8% per year.

The current estimated value of £172,180 is:

  • 42.2% higher than the average property price on Morlais Street
  • 20.8% higher than the average in the CF63 2PB postcode area
  • and 34.0% lower than the average price for Barry as a whole

This property has had 2 EPC inspections with recorded tenure information. It was recorded once as rented and once as owner-occupied, indicating a change in how it was used over time.

At the most recent EPC inspection on 8 November 2024, the property was recorded as rented.

12 Morlais Street, Barry, The Vale Of Glamorgan, South Glamorgan, CF63 2PB has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of D, based on the latest assessment carried out on 8 Nov 2024.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 13 Aug 2014, and the property received the same rating of D with an unchanged energy efficiency score of 60.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 100 mm loft insulation to pitched, no insulation (assumed), changing energy efficiency from average to very poor.
  • The wall construction or insulation changed from sandstone, as built, no insulation (assumed) to solid brick, as built, no insulation (assumed), with no change in energy efficiency (very poor).
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in 64% of fixed outlets to low energy lighting in all f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from good to very good.
